wifi: mac80211: send DelBA with correct BSSID
In MLO, the deflink BSSID is clearly invalid. Since we fill the addresses as MLD addresses and translate later, use the AP address here instead. This fixes an issue that happens with HW restart, where the DelBA frame is transmitted, but not processed correctly due to the wrong BSSID (or even just discarded entirely). As a result, the BA sessions are kept alive; however, as other state is reset during HW restart, this then fails (reorder, etc.) and data doesn't go through until new BA sessions are established.
